To Our Shareholders
- --------------------------------------------------------------------------------

         Let us report on the business results of Advantest (the "Company") on a
consolidated basis during the interim period of fiscal year 2005 (April 1, 2005
through September 30, 2005).

         During this interim fiscal period, although inventory control in the IT
related industries continued during the first half of this interim period,
Advantest's operating environment was favorable, as stimulated by the strong
demand for consumer digital products and personal computers, particularly
notebooks computers, and due to the trend towards recovery in capital
expenditures by the semiconductor industry. In particular, the increased demand
for portable audio players worldwide and the spread of flat screen television
led to an increase in semiconductor sale. In addition, the trend towards a
weaker yen in currency exchange was a positive factor.

         Under this environment, Advantest made concentrated efforts to increase
orders input received and expand sales through the timely introduction of new
products that meet customers' demands. Advantest continued to make efforts to
improve productivity and profitability through reorganization of its
manufacturing operations, as well as by implementing measures to further reduce
lead-time and to reduce costs.

         As a result of the above, as compared to the corresponding interim
period of the previous fiscal year, during which Advantest achieved the highest
net sales of any interim period, orders input received decreased by 2.9% to
(Y)121.6 billion, net sales decreased by 26.9% to (Y)107.1 billion, net income
before income taxes decreased by 46.8% to (Y)24.5 billion, and interim net
income decreased by 47.5% to (Y)14.6 billion. As compared to the second half of
the previous fiscal year, however, Advantest returned to an increase in profit
and an increase in income as orders input received increased by 18.9%, net sales
increased by 15.3%, net income before income taxes increased by 55.8%, and
interim net income increased by 42.4% indicating a recovery trend. Overseas
sales as a percentage of total sales were 67.7%, as compared with 74.3% in the
corresponding interim period of the previous fiscal year.

         Interim dividends of (Y)25 per share as compared to (Y)25 in the
corresponding interim period for the previous fiscal year will be distributed to
shareholders beginning on December 1, 2005, as resolved by the Board of
Directors' Meeting on October 26, 2005.

Business Results by Segment

Semiconductor and Component Test System Segment

         In this segment, as inventory adjustment by IT related industries
approached completion, and demand for new test systems increased as a result of
increased production of semiconductors.

         In the memory test system market, due to increased production of NAND
type flash memory used in products such as portable audio players, sales in
flash memory test systems remained strong domestically and overseas. With
respect to DRAM test systems, sales remained strong due to respective sales in
high-speed memory semiconductor test system for DDR2, a high-speed,
high-efficiency and memory test systems for DRAM for consumer digital products
in certain geographic areas.

         In the market of non-memory semiconductor test system, stimulated by
strong sales in personal computers, sales of the T2000, a test system compatible
with OPENSTAR(R), was very strong. In addition, sales in SoC semiconductor test
system for game devices and devices used in consumer digital products and sales
of test systems for LCD driver IC remained positive domestically and in Taiwan.
With respect to other test systems, sales of test systems for CCD, used in
digital cameras, and the test systems for semiconductors related to automobiles
remained steady.

         As a result of the above, orders input received was (Y)93.7 billion
(2.5% decrease in comparison to the corresponding interim period of the previous
fiscal year), sales was (Y)80.8 billion (28.6% decrease) and operating income
was (Y)21.0 billion (44.4% decrease).

Mechatronics System Segment

         Stimulated by the positive sales of the T2000 and non-memory test
systems for digital consumer products, sales in non-memory semiconductor test
handlers remained steady. Sales of memory test handlers was weaker due to a lag
in the sales of DRAM test systems. On the other hand, sales of device interface
products was steady, due to the increased demand for flash memory semiconductor
and semiconductor for SoC.

         As a result, orders input received was (Y)21.7 billion (12.1% decrease
in comparison with the corresponding interim period of the previous fiscal
year), sales was (Y)20.5 billion (27.1% decrease) and operating income was
(Y)4.6 billion (53.9% decrease).

Prospects for the Fiscal Year
- --------------------------------------------------------------------------------

         Regarding its operating environment in the upcoming fiscal year,
Advantest expects to see expanded volume and application of flash memory used
for digital cameras or portable audio players, and a continuing increase in the
demand for non-memory semiconductors for consumer digital products. With respect
to DRAM, Advantest expects a rapid shift to DDR2 for servers and high-tech
personal computers. Furthermore, continued active capital expenditures relating
to 300mm wafers by the semiconductor manufactures and foundries are expected.

         On the other hand, restrained capital expenditures as a result of poor
supply and demand balance, an issue unique to the semiconductor market,
increased prices of raw materials such as oil, currency risk attributable to a
strong yen, and strengthened downward pressure on prices as a result of the
above-mentioned factors may affect our results.

         In order to respond to these conditions, Advantest plans to continue
its efforts to increase orders input received and expand sales through the
timely introduction of new products that meets customers' needs by strengthening
marketing and development structure. To further strengthen its cost
competitiveness, Advantest will make continued efforts to improve profitability
by reviewing its operational process company wide and improving manufacturing
efficiency.

         As a result of the above, net sales for the fiscal year are currently
estimated at (Y)240.0 billion, while income before income taxes is estimated at
(Y)61.0 billion and net income at (Y)37.0 billion.
